The primary focus of Dale's eco-feminist art practice is landart-- earthworks and ephemeral, organic installations that bring the spirit of Mother Nature into both traditional and non-traditional spaces.
Her sources/resources for the site-specific works come from a commitment to both the personal and political spheres of daily life as well as the profound influence of the land and the community.
A BFA graduate of the University of Ottawa, Canada and successful on Canadian terms of shows and grants, Dale survives through her love of teaching sculpture and eco-art, and the love and patronage of her partner, Yves Meunier.
